Alaska Native Brotherhood and recognizing rights History of the Tlingit






two tlingit brothers created alaska native brotherhood in 1912 in sitka in order pursue privileges of whites in area @ time. alaska native sisterhood followed. anb , ans function nonprofit organizations serving assist in societal development , preservation of native culture, , ensure people treated equally.


elizabeth peratrovich renowned member of ans whom in 1988 state of alaska designated state holiday, february 16. peratrovich s husband, frank, president of native brotherhood, of mixed tlingit , serbian descent. serbian , montenegrin immigrants commonly mixed tlingit in 19th century due common religion, , orthodox church in juneau built group of orthodox tlingit , serbs.
